Local Events and Festivals
Coogee hosts a vibrant array of local events that reflect its community spirit and cultural diversity. The annual Coogee Family Carnival usually draws families and visitors alike, offering live music, amusement rides, and a variety of market stalls. This festive gathering is just one of many that takes place throughout the year, showcasing local talent and bringing residents together for a day of fun and entertainment.
The Coogee Surf Lifesaving Club plays an integral role in the community, organizing beach-related events that promote water safety and camaraderie. Events like the Coogee Beach Ocean Swim not only encourage physical fitness but also foster a sense of unity among participants. Such activities highlight the area's emphasis on outdoor living and its commitment to sustainable community engagement while celebrating its coastal environment.

Notable Institutions
Coogee is home to several educational institutions that cater to the diverse needs of its residents. Coogee Public School offers a well-rounded educational experience for younger students, focusing on both academic achievement and social development. Another notable establishment is the Coogee Prep, known for its commitment to early childhood education and nurturing a love of learning in children.
Additionally, several nearby high schools provide quality education and various extracurricular activities. Randwick Boys High School and Randwick Girls High School are prominent choices for secondary education. These institutions emphasize academic excellence while also encouraging participation in sports and cultural programs, contributing to the overall growth of their students.
